I try to buy HUO and look at the condition of the 1 I am buying and the others the seller has.Usually if you see all the sellers personal machines are kept up then its going to be a good machine.Big difference on older machines they can have a long history of plays and still be in good shape.There are also many types of buyers and sellers I prefer newer low play games but others love all games and are willing to put in the time and work to get a game back from the dead.Both are enjoying Pinball .
